COMMERCIAL DESCRIPTION Cask; Special - January/February 2011 (Single Hop Series). Fuggle (or Fuggles) is possibly the best known English hop variety, and dates as a variety from 1875 when it was ’developed’ by Mr Richard Fuggle, a hop grower from Kent. Once the mainstay of British Brewing, it is now outclassed commercially by more modern varieties, and whilst still popular with smaller breweries, it is a declining variety in terms of volumes grown each year, and may well be at risk of disappearing in years to come.
